“Come And Play For Us” – Newcastle Begs Iheanacho

Struggling Newscastle have reportedly lined up a move for rejuvenated Leicester City striker, Kelechi Iheanacho.

Newcastle are in the market to land a proven striker before the close of January’s transfer window on Wednesday night after  a 3-0 bashing by Chelsea sent them packing from the FA Cup.

Iheanacho, who is experiencing a resurgence at the Foxes, is being lined up by Rafa Benitez’s Newcastle as plan B in case a bid to land Feyenoord’s Danish striker Nicolai Jorgensen fails.

Feyenoord demanded £20 million forJorgensen, a price the Magpies are unwilling to pay.

However, Benitez has renewed interest in Iheanacho, who shunned interest from Newcastle in the summer to join Leicester City in a £25 million move.

Kelechi Iheanacho scored twice in Leicester’s 5-1 FA Cup demolition of Peterborough on Saturday, taking his strikes to four in the competition.

This is believed to be fuelling Newcastle’s interest in the forward.
